Output 8c516486f5565106fec143c27126ed6853b69ebd3a24951c14f176d62feb5757:0

value
100484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b31948c9c47494444473d35555ca0c8026d5053 OP_EQUAL
address
3EP1F765BvsV1fD4hA9yH8LcyLBWN13rrv
transaction
8c516486f5565106fec143c27126ed6853b69ebd3a24951c14f176d62feb5757
confirmations
426663
spent
true